Concrete, Brick, and Asphalt Heavy-debris Pricing

Dense materials need the right container. Our reinforced-steel lowboy roll-offs handle concrete slab tear-out, brick demo, asphalt millings, and clean dirt — up to 10,000 pounds per load. The low 2-to-3-foot walls let skid steers and wheelbarrows load over the rim without busting USDOT truck weight limits on Tiverton routes.

Heavy-debris jobs run on weight tickets from the scale house, not by the yard; clean loads—those without mixed wood, drywall, or trash—earn the lowest per-ton rate. Tonnage Limits and Weight Overage Policy

Every construction roll-off includes a set tonnage allowance: additional weight is billed at our published per-ton rate based on the scale-house ticket. Your upfront quote lists the total cap for that specific container; we want to avoid surprises when the truck weighs in.
